What Would it Profit?

“No one can make you feel inferior without your consent.” – Eleanor Roosevelt

Why should I be concerned about how another sees me? What will the approval of another provide for me? Will it increase my knowledge? Will it increase my bank account? What will it give me other than the satisfaction of knowing you approve of me? And if you approve of me, does it even matter?

In most cases, when we think of the word profit we relate it to finance. But, the word also means an advantage or benefit. Which, can be associated with anything in life.

A few days ago, I encountered negativity at work. And to be perfectly honest, I was extremely despondent over the incident. I do not claim to be perfect because I’m not. I acknowledge that I am flawed. However, I take pride in doing my job well and hearing anything to the contrary bothers me immensely.

But, I learned an invaluable lesson through this experience. I also had the opportunity to reinforce things I already knew.

It is vital to have a support system that can and will help you get through difficult moments. But, more importantly we must know who we are. The only way someone can make us feel small is if we give them the power to do so.

This incident reminded me of the words of another former First Lady of the United States, Michelle Obama.

“When they go low, we go high” – Michelle Obama

And based on my upbringing, there is nothing higher than my beliefs.

“But I say unto you, Love your enemies, bless them that curse you, do good to them that hate you, and pray for them which despitefully use you, and persecute you; “- Matthew 5:44 KJV
